Event Name: Nedbank Tour de TuliWhen: 19/07/2022 - 24/07/2022Where: Category: Mountain BikeNedbank Tour de Tuli - Africa’s wildest ride The Nedbank Tour de Tuli, now in its 18th year, is an award-winning, exclusive African mountain biking tour, offering 350 riders access to single tracks, unmarked routes and ancient game trails across wilderness areas in three countries. The event, hosted in July, is the primary fundraiser for the Children in the Wilderness organisation. Children in the Wilderness is a non-profit organisation supported by conservation tourism company Wilderness Safaris, the Nedbank Tour de Tuli and countless volunteers. Its aim is to facilitate sustainable conservation through leadership development and education of children in Africa.  Distance(s): 300 km (60-80 kms per day) Route: This year’s route will once again traverse the Greater Mapungubwe Transfrontier Conservation Area, which includes South Africa, Zimbabwe and Botswana.  Riding will be predominantly along ancient elephant trails, allowing riders the opportunity of experiencing wonderful scenery, cultural interaction and seeing wildlife. Each year the route is altered to ensure that the Tour remains exciting and continues to incorporate new areas that we are allowed to traverse.
